班长的泪水C语言学习中的挫折与成长

  • 媒体报道
  • 2024年11月24日
  • 在这个充满挑战的学期里,我们的一个班长经历了一段难忘的时光。起初,他是我们小组中最自信的一位,总能快速解决复杂的问题。但是,当他开始深入学习C语言的时候,他遇到了前所未有的困难。 第一个点:面对陌生的语法 C语言作为一种古老而强大的编程语言,其语法简洁却又富有挑战性。当我们的班长尝试着写他的第一个程序时,他发现自己无法理解那些看似简单却实际上极其复杂的指针操作。他尝试了各种方法

班长的泪水C语言学习中的挫折与成长

在这个充满挑战的学期里,我们的一个班长经历了一段难忘的时光。起初,他是我们小组中最自信的一位,总能快速解决复杂的问题。但是,当他开始深入学习C语言的时候,他遇到了前所未有的困难。

第一个点:面对陌生的语法

C语言作为一种古老而强大的编程语言,其语法简洁却又富有挑战性。当我们的班长尝试着写他的第一个程序时,他发现自己无法理解那些看似简单却实际上极其复杂的指针操作。他尝试了各种方法,从网上的教程到书本上的解释,但每次阅读都让他感到头大。最后,在一次课堂讨论中,他崩溃了,哭着喊说不能再做C了,这个视频作文成了他情感宣泄的一种方式。

第二个点:代码bug的无休止循环

在后续几周里,班长不断地练习,但是他的代码总是在运行过程中出现bug。这让他感到非常沮丧,因为无论多么努力,每次修改都会带来新的问题。他甚至怀疑自己是否适合学习编程。但是,不断地失败并没有打败他的决心,而是一个接一个的小进步终于使他掌握了如何有效地调试和优化代码。

第三个点:团队合作中的启发

为了帮助班长克服困难,我们小组决定集体攻关。在这段时间里,我们不仅为他的代码提供帮助,还一起讨论解决方案。这种团队合作精神给予了大家力量,让每个人都从中学到了许多。通过这样的互相支持,他们不仅解决了具体的问题,也培养出了更坚韧的心态。

第四个点:理论与实践相结合

当我们的班长意识到理论知识并不能直接转化为实际应用能力时,他开始更加注重将书本知识运用到项目中去。他找到了一个简单但实用的项目,比如计算器或游戏,并且成功地将自己的理解付诸实践。这一过程不仅加深了他的理解,也提高了他们对于编程原理的认识。

第五个点:反思与自我提升

经过一段时间的沉淀和反思,班长意识到过去那种盲目追求高分、忽视细节的情况是不正确的。他学会了一种更加谨慎和耐心的地道学习方式,并且对自己的不足进行了解析,以此来制定更好的学习计划。此外,对于未来可能遇到的其他编程任务或技术障碍也提前做好准备,这样一来,即便再遇困难也不至于崩溃。

第六点:成果展现与分享

随着技能水平的提升,班长逐渐能够独立完成较复杂的问题,并且还会主动向同学们展示自己的作品。在一次学校级别的小型科技展览上,他展示了一款利用C语言实现的人工智能助手,这项作品引起 了老师们和同学们的大力赞扬。这次荣誉既是对过去努力工作的一个认可,也激励着他继续探索更多可能性,无论是在学术还是职业道路上都是宝贵财富。

下载本文txt文件